摘要

The production of marine microalgae in photobioreactors (PBR) has long been demonstrated only for species such as Nannochloropsis sp., however others such as Tetraselmis sp. and Isochrysis sp. (T-ISO) are regularly grown in bags with green-water system. In this study, these three species were cultured in traditional polyethylene 400 L bags or in 2-m acrylic 100 L column PBRs to compare densities attained, productivity and the biochemical composition of the harvested biomass.
